Paseo de Gracia Penthouse is a minimalist house located in Barcelona, Spain, designed by CaSA. The property had a big limit the architects had to overcome: low ceilings and big beams hanging below them. This implied a difficulty in passing ducts and installations and in how to divide the layout. In the end the rooms have been distributed by placing the walls along the existing beams, exposed. They opted to incorporate the beams, exposed, into the project and make them part of it.
